HR1820 Series B3 HY-RAIL® Guide Wheel Equipment

Harsco Rail's HR1820 Series B3 HY-RAIL® Guide Wheel Attachments adapt medium duty chassis-cab trucks and similar vehicles meeting HTT's recommended vehicle specifications, for railway applications requiring travel on the highway and on the rail.

These units are ideal for applications utilizing vehicles in the medium duty range, and that have a front axle width not compatible to track gauge.

Model 1820 Series B3 guide wheel equipment consists of a vertical lift type front unit and an individual wheel arm type rear unit. The front unit features coil spring suspension and the rear unit is disc-spring equipped to provide a smooth ride, enhance on-rail traction of the vehicle's drive wheels, and help maintain essential guide wheel to rail contact.

Guide wheels are raised and lowered hydraulically with power supplied from vehicle equipment systems or from an optional power pack. Double-acting hydraulic cylinders make raising and lowering of each unit easy. Positioning of the guide wheels is controlled by manually-actuated valves located at each unit.

Positive mechanical locks secured by safety pins retain the guide wheels in both the highway and rail positions.

Major Features

  • Vertical-lift front unit minimizes front end overhang for easier handling and a smoother highway ride.
  • Individual wheel arm design of rear unit increases vehicle payload capacity and simplifies mounting. This feature allows compact mounting around rear fuel tanks.

HR1820 Series B3 HY-RAIL® Unit Specifications

  • Compatible Vehicles
    • Type: Light-duty, cab-chassis trucks and utility vehicles
    • Weight Class:
      • GAWR-Front: 7,000-lbs (3,175-kg)
      • GAWR-Rear: 13,500-lbs (6,123-kg)
  • Guide Wheel Units
    • Construction: Fabricated steel unit; welded and bolted construction
    • Attachment to Vehicle: Universally mountable front unit bolts to vehicle front end with custom mounting brackets specific to each approved vehicle model; universally mountable rear unit bolts to vehicle chassis rails. Units are fitted with incrementally spaced mounting holes facilitating full adjustment of unit mounting for vehicle's frame height, base curb weight and on-rail tracking.
    • Suspension:
      • Front Unit: Coil Spring
      • Rear Unit: Disc-spring - Adjustable preload
    • Rail Wheels: Austempered ductile iron; precision machined
    • Tread Diameter: 11.00-in. (279.4-mm)
    • Flange Diameter: 13.25-in. (336.5-mm)
    • Wheel Bearings: Heavy-duty, tapered roller; re-lubrication by hand pack method
    • Brakes: (Recommended safety option) - Brakes on each front and rear rail wheel; actuated by in-cab control.
    • Safety Locks:
      • Front Unit: Pin type positive mechanical lock on each guide tube; locked in rail and highway positions; lock pins secured by a retainer pin.
      • Rear Unit: Positive mechanical lock on unit in highway position; hydraulically locked in rail position.
    • Derail Skids: Built-in; standard on front and rear units
    • Rail Sweeps - Front: Bolt-on; manually actuated; (recommended safety option for front unit)
    • Rail Sweeps - Rear: Bolt-on; fixed-adjustable; (recommended safety option for rear unit)
    • Raise/Lower Actuation: Hydraulic; double-acting cylinders; manual control valve located on each unit.
    • Bumpers: Front bumper w/sight rods-standard
  • Weights & Dimensions
    • Front Unit: 463-lbs. (210-kg)
    • Rear Unit: 463-lbs. (210-kg)
    • Track Gauge: 56.5-in. (1435-mm) - Standard
  • Load Capacity
    • Front Unit: 7,000-lbs. (3,175-kg) / 3,500-lbs. (1,588-kg) maximum load per wheel
    • Rear Unit: 6,750-lbs. (3,062-kg) / 3,375-lbs. (1,531-kg) maximum load per wheel
  • Required Auxiliary Equipment
    • Steering Lock: Steering column mounted; manual actuation on steering wheel
    • Mounting Brackets & Spacers: Specific design for each approved vehicle model
    • Axle Lock for Vehicle Front Axle: Hook-type; positioned under vehicle axle by push/pull rods located on front unit.
  • Hydraulic System Requirements
    • Flow Range: 5-8-gpm (18.9-30.2-lpm)
    • Operating Pressure:
      • Front Unit: 1,800-psi (124.1-bar) maximum
      • Rear Unit: 2,200-psi ( 151.7-bar) maximum
